What is LIC Maturity Value?

The LIC maturity value is the amount you receive once your policy term ends. This amount includes:

  • Sum Assured – The guaranteed amount promised by LIC at maturity.
  • Reversionary Bonus – Declared annually by LIC, linked to company profits.
  • Final Additional Bonus (FAB) – A one-time bonus at maturity (if applicable).
  • Guaranteed Additions – Fixed additions in some policies, independent of profits.
  • Survival Benefits – In money-back plans, part of the maturity comes as periodic payouts during the policy term.

How Does the LIC Maturity Calculator Work?

Our LIC Maturity Calculator Online uses the following formula:

Maturity Value = Sum Assured + (Bonus Rate × Policy Term × (Sum Assured ÷ 1000)) + Final Bonus + Guaranteed Additions + Survival Benefits

Example of LIC Maturity Calculation

Example:

Policy Type: Endowment Plan

Sum Assured: ₹5,00,000

Policy Term: 20 years

Bonus Rate: ₹45 per ₹1000 sum assured per year

Final Bonus: ₹25,000

Guaranteed Additions: ₹50,000


Total Maturity Value = ₹10,25,000

Can You Calculate LIC Maturity by Policy Number?

Many users search for a LIC maturity calculator by policy number. While no online tool can directly fetch your maturity value using just the policy number, you can still:

  • Input details from your policy bond into the calculator.
  • Get an approximate maturity value using bonus rates and term.
  • Contact your LIC agent for exact figures.

Key Factors Affecting LIC Maturity Amount

  • Policy Type – Endowment, Money Back, or Whole Life.
  • Policy Term – Longer terms usually earn higher bonuses.
  • Sum Assured – Higher sum assured means bigger payouts.
  • Bonus Rates – Vary depending on LIC’s annual performance.
  • Additional Benefits – Loyalty additions, guaranteed additions, or survival benefits.

The LIC maturity amount is the total amount you receive at the end of your policy term. It is calculated by adding the Sum Assured, plus any Accrued Bonuses, plus Final Additional Bonus (if applicable). For example, if your policy's Sum Assured is ₹5,00,000 and you have accrued bonuses of ₹1,50,000 with a final bonus of ₹20,000, then your maturity amount will be ₹6,70,000.
